The Wellness Edit: Stop waiting for a 2-hour window. 🌿
Last week I talked about giving yourself permission to shift gears this season. But let’s be honest about what usually happens next…
The moment our regular routines shift, a quiet little voice sneaks in telling us we’ve “fallen off track.”
We convince ourselves that if we don’t have a full hour to commit—if we can’t do things perfectly—then it doesn’t count at all. So we do nothing. And then we carry around this background guilt about doing nothing.
Wellbeing doesn’t have to be a grand, high-maintenance production.
It can literally just be five minutes of sanity:
Sitting outside with a hot drink for 5 minutes without checking your phone.
Taking three slow, conscious breaths in the car before walking into the house.
Lying on the living room floor to stretch while you watch TV at night.
You don’t need two uninterrupted hours to come back to yourself. You just need a few seconds of intention.
Stop waiting for a clear schedule that isn’t coming this week. Take the 5 messy, quiet minutes you actually have.
This Week’s Read 📚
Tiny Habits by BJ Fogg.
If you struggle with the “all-or-nothing” trap, this book is a game-changer. BJ Fogg (a Stanford behavior scientist) proves that real, lasting change doesn’t come from massive overhauls or willpower—it comes from making habits so impossibly small that they feel effortless to fit into real life. Perfect for when life feels full and routine feels rigid.

The Wellness Edit ✨

The conversations around social media restrictions for young people have got me thinking.

Whilst many adults can see the potential benefits, I think it’s important we acknowledge something:

Change is hard.

For today’s teenagers, social media isn’t simply an app.

It’s where friendships are maintained.
It’s where they communicate.
It’s where they feel connected to their world.

So whilst change may ultimately be positive, we can’t ignore the anxiety, uncertainty and resistance many young people will feel in the process.

My biggest question isn’t whether change is coming.

It’s how we support young people through it.

How do we help them build confidence, connection and belonging away from a screen?

How do we support families who are already stretched?

And how do we model the healthy behaviours we hope to see in them?

Perhaps the conversation starts with us.

Looking honestly at our own relationship with technology.
Creating more opportunities for real-world connection.
And remembering that young people learn far more from what we do than what we say.
